Program Analyst, Journeyman Job at Belcan Government Services
Job Description
Performs program review and analysis for Product Manager (PdM), Multi-Mission Surveillance Systems (M2S2) weapon systems. Primarily serve as an analyst to management on the evaluation of the program's effectiveness and operations regarding its productivity and efficiency. Requires an understanding of government budgetary and financial management principles and techniques as they relate to near term and long-range planning of the program and objectives. Analyzes project milestones and budgets. Activities include leading or participating in special projects, acquisition reporting to higher authority, routine and special project office reporting, preparation of high-level documents and reports, milestone documentation oversight and tracking. Reviews individual project progress, measuring performance and recommends corrective actions to maintain agreed upon schedule and cost and overall program accomplishments. Monitors individual project objectives, milestones, and budgets within the overall program objectives. Requires skill in application of fact-finding and investigative techniques; oral and written communications; and development of presentations and reports. Prepares correspondence relevant to projects/programs.
